But some people really can't handle such a disappointment. In the American state of Iowa, for example, where a 42-year-old man found out at home that they had forgotten the sauce for his chicken nuggets. SHAME! And what do you do at Maccie?

You blow the whole place up.
Well, that was indeed his plan. When the dissatisfied customer finally got home, discovered the tragedy of the missing dipping sauce, and picked up the phone to tell those McDonald's employees the truth, he announced that he was going to blow up their branch. That didn't really sit well with the employee, who called the police.

In the end, the man managed to convince the police that he really didn't mean it, but that did involve a night in jail and then he had to appear before the judge to account for this statement.
